Openmp parallel for nested loops

WebIf execution of any associated loop changes any of the values used to compute any of the iteration counts, then the behavior is unspecified. You can use collapse when this is not the case for example with a square loop. #pragma omp parallel for private(j) collapse(2) for (i = 0; i < 4; i++) for (j = 0; j < 100; j++) WebIntro for nowait schedule nested Hyper-threading Memory More Examples. OpenMP parallel for loops: waiting. When you use a parallel region, OpenMP will automatically …

C 如何使此依赖的并行版本嵌套,以及为什么折叠不起 ...

WebPython 列表的唯一列表,python,list,nested-loops,Python,List,Nested Loops,我有一个嵌套列表作为示例: lst_a = [[1,2,3,5], [1,2,3,7], [1,2,3,9], [1,2,6,8]] 我试图检查嵌套列表元素的前3个索引是否与其他索引相同 即 如果[1,2,3]存在于其他列表中,请删除包含该元素的所有其他嵌套列表元素。 Web12 de nov. de 2012 · How does OpenMP handle nested loops? Does the following code just parallelize the first (outer) loops, or it parallelize the entire nested loops? #pragma omp parallel for for (int i=0;i earthworm jim trout https://netzinger.com

Episode 4.5 - Parallel Loops, Private and Shared Variables, …

Web12 de mar. de 2024 · The first way I went about parallising this using openMP was just by parallising the for loops of each equation but still going through each equation 1 by 1, … Web15 de jun. de 2012 · I have a question on the omp parallelization in the nested loop. I want to parallelize the outer loop by omp while in the inner loop a loop-dependent array "temp" is used. Without the omp inplementation, this serial of codes work well. But when I set "temp" to be private, and run it, it complains "Segmentation fault!". Web27 de mar. de 2024 · Enable handling of OpenMP directives and generate parallel code. The openmp library to be linked can be specified through -fopenmp=library option. -flto; COPTIMIZE, ... Enables loop strength reduction for nested loop structures. By default, the compiler performs loop strength reduction only for the innermost loop.-fopenmp=libomp; … earthworm jim theme song

Parallel For Loops with OpenMP - The Supercomputing Blog

Category:C++ : How does OpenMP handle nested loops? - YouTube

Tags:Openmp parallel for nested loops

Openmp parallel for nested loops

GitHub - classner/pymp: Easy, OpenMP style multiprocessing for …

Web19 de mar. de 2015 · Unfortunately I can't get seem to get 'OpenMP DEFINED LOOP WAS PARALLELIZED' using the suggested replacement, in combination with other -Qopt … WebC++ : How does OpenMP handle nested loops?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So here is a secret hidden feature ...

Openmp parallel for nested loops

Did you know?

Web4.3 Using OpenMP Library Routines Within Nested Parallel Regions. Calls to the following OpenMP routines within nested parallel regions deserve some discussion. - … WebNot enough parallel work: The number of loop iterations is less than the number of working threads so several threads from the team are waiting at the barrier not doing useful work at all. Synchronization on locks: When synchronization objects are used inside a parallel region, threads can wait on a lock release, contending with other threads for a shared …

Web11 de fev. de 2013 · Overview Part I: Parallel Computing Basic Concepts – Memory models – Data parallelism Part II: OpenMP Tutorial – Important features – Examples & programming tips http://duoduokou.com/c/34702464562471666708.html

WebC 如何使此依赖的并行版本嵌套,以及为什么折叠不起作用,c,multithreading,parallel-processing,openmp,nested-loops,C,Multithreading,Parallel … WebOpenMP: ParallelFor HPC Education 2.66K subscribers Subscribe 131 10K views 2 years ago OpenMP Concepts Hey guys! Welcome to HPC Education! And today we’ll be looking at the Parallel For...

Web14 de mai. de 2009 · I have a question regarding nested OpenMP for-loops in applications where the outer-most for-loop is poorly load balanced. Suppose you have a double for-loop like so (it may not always be so ...

Web19 de dez. de 2024 · Algorithm: Start the program. There are many for loops in the program. Add the for loop construct before all the for loops. num_threads ( n ) needs to be mentioned to get n threads. If not mentioned, by default, the no. of processor’s scores threads are formed. So therefore parallelized. earthworm jim special edition romhttp://duoduokou.com/c/34702464562471666708.html ct scan nasopharynxWebC 如何使此依赖的并行版本嵌套,以及为什么折叠不起作用,c,multithreading,parallel-processing,openmp,nested-loops,C,Multithreading,Parallel Processing,Openmp,Nested Loops,我如何将其与OpenMP 3.1并行? ct scan neckhttp://duoduokou.com/python/50866693828584571331.html ct scan nauseaWeb13 de jul. de 2009 · Parallel for loops. This tutorial will be exploring just some of the ways in which you can use OpenMP to allow your loops in your program to run on multiple … ct scan neck labeledWebVideo course: Parallel Programming and Optimization with Intel Xeon Phi Coprocessors Episode 4.5 - Parallel Loops, Private and Shared Variables, Scheduling Vadim Karpusenko 917 subscribers... earthworm jim tubiWebLoop is nested inside another loop that is parallelized. No . No . Loop is in a subroutine called within the body of a ... write(6,1) j 1 format(’Line number ’, i3, ’.’) end demo% f95 -openmp t13.f demo% setenv PARALLEL 4 demo% a.out: Line number 9. Line number 4. Line number 5. Line number 6. Line number 1. Line number 2. Line ... ct scan neck cpt